Digitalising accounting records archiving: what actually works

Access for the fiduciary, the auditor and employees is set by roles: view, enter, approve, close. Well-set rights protect the data and speed up collaboration.

Electronic archiving is fully recognised: Swiss bookkeeping regulation admits electronic retention of records provided integrity and readability are guaranteed for the 10 years of art. 958f CO. A paper binder is no longer an obligation — provided the archiving system is serious.

Outsource accounting records archiving or keep it in-house?

A fiduciary's cost depends first on the quality of the data received: digitised, filed, reconciled documents are processed fast; a box of loose receipts is billed by the hour. Improving the internal preparation of accounting records archiving lowers fees more surely than any negotiation.

In Fiez, as everywhere, the right collaboration rhythm follows the activity: monthly for payroll and data entry, quarterly for VAT, yearly for the closing and tax advice.

A well-structured SME chart of accounts

Nearly all Swiss SMEs rely on the standard SME chart of accounts (Sterchi/Käfer): classes 1 (assets) to 9 (closing), with revenue in class 3 and expenses in classes 4 to 6. Using this standard structure makes conversations with your fiduciary, auditor and tax administration far easier.

For a business in Fiez, comparability over time beats sophistication: a chart stable for five years beats a “perfect” one rebuilt every year. Banks and the tax administration read year-on-year movements first.

Frequently asked questions

When is entry in the commercial register mandatory?

A Sàrl and an SA only come into existence with their registration. A sole proprietorship must register from CHF 100,000 of annual revenue; below that, registration stays voluntary but adds credibility and protects the business name. Registration goes through the canton's commercial register office — for Fiez too.

Effective VAT method or net tax rate: how to choose?

The effective method deducts actual input VAT and files quarterly; the net tax rate method applies a flat industry rate to turnover, semi-annually, with no separate input VAT deduction. The flat rate suits low-cost structures; as investments grow, the effective method usually wins again. The choice rests on the company's own figures, in Fiez as anywhere.

What are the current Swiss VAT rates?

Since 1 January 2024: 8.1% (standard), 2.6% (reduced — for example food and medicines) and 3.8% (accommodation). Returns must be filed and paid within 60 days after the period ends (quarterly under the effective method, semi-annually under the net tax rate method). These federal rates apply unchanged in Fiez.
